Circular route in the north of Peneda-Gerês National Park from the Lima Escape campsite

The walk starts at the Lima Escape campsite, but it is also possible to set off from the village of Entre Ambos-os-Rios. Part of the walk takes place in an area that was burnt a few years ago, but the paths are still clearly visible and safe. There are magnificent and varied landscapes.

Description of the walk

The route starts and finishes at the Lima Escape campsite, but it is possible to set off from the village of Entre Ambos-Os-Rios.
There is no dedicated signposting as this route follows various marked trails. The trails are always well maintained, despite passing through a section of woodland that burnt down a few years ago.
